Sheriff: 56 animals escaped from farm near Zanesville; 48 were killed by authorities
10-19-2011
•
www.dispatch.com
The animals that were killed included 18 tigers, nine male lions, eight female lions, six black bears, three mountain lions, two grizzly bears, one baboon and one wolf, Sheriff Matt Lutz said.
